🔼 How Sweet It Is! No. 2 seed Michigan State women’s soccer has punched its ticket to the Sweet 16 for the third season in a row, using a goal from Kayla Briggs in the 69th minute of action against Wake Forest to beat the Demon Deacons, 1-0, at DeMartin Stadium!

The Spartans will again play at home on Sunday, hosting Colorado at 1 p.m. The Buffs are 17-3-3 overall this season with wins over Utah Valley and Xavier in the NCAA Tournament.

🔼 More At Munn. No. 1 Michigan State hockey is back at Munn Ice Arena this weekend, hosting No. 7 Wisconsin for a pair of games.

The Badgers are 8-2-2 overall this season and 4-2-0 in Big Ten play.

🔼 Kickin’ At Kinnick. Michigan State football plays its final true road game of the season tomorrow, kicking off at Iowa at 3:30 p.m. on FS1.

The Spartans beat Iowa in East Lansing last season, 32-20, led by Jonathan Kim's school-record six field goals.

🔼 Century Mark. No. 22 Michigan State women’s basketball’s high-powered offense stole the show again on Thursday night, winning 101-52 over Eastern Illinois to improve to 5-0 on the season.

The Spartans are averaging 102.4 points per game through five games, scoring at least 92 points in every game so far.

🔼 Three In A Row! Michigan State’s Ozan Baris won again on Thursday at the NCAA Individual Championships, securing a spot in the quarterfinals for a third year in a row!

🔼 Last Lap. Michigan State cross country’s season concludes tomorrow morning, with the Spartans in Columbia, Mo. to race at the NCAA Championships.

The Spartan men will race as a team, while Rachel Forsyth will represent the Spartan women individually.

🔼 Away From Home. Michigan State volleyball hits the road this weekend for the final time during the regular season, traveling to No. 24 Penn State (15-11, 9-7 B1G) today and Ohio State (5-19, 2-14 B1G) on Sunday.

🔼 Brotherly Battle. Michigan State wrestling takes a step back from dual action this weekend, instead traveling to Philadelphia to compete at the Keystone Classic this Sunday.
